MARC Technocrats Limited is engaged in the business of infrastructure consultancy services, comprising Supervision andQuality Control (SQC), preparation of Detailed Project Reports (DPRs), Third-Party Techno-Financial Auditor andPre-Bid Advisory services. They provide the services for the infrastructure projects, such as roads and highways, railways, buildings, and water resources. The company primarily operates on a Business-to-Government (B2G) model, with the majority of the revenue derived from delivering the services to government department and ministries such as Ministry of Road Transport and Highways (MoRTH), National Highways and Infrastructure Development Corporation Limited (NHIDCL), National Highways Authority of India (NHAI), Public Works Departments (PWDs) and Railways. As per financial performance, MARC Technocrats Limited has posted total income / net profits of Rs 20.57 Cr / 2.63 Cr (FY23), Rs 26.94 Cr / Rs 3.45 Cr (FY24), Rs 48.55 Cr / 7.47 Cr (FY25) and Rs 32.63 Cr / 5.75 (upto Q2 FY26). So as per previous financials data, company has shown good growth. As of September 30, 2025, the order book for the consultancy services business was approximately Rs. 25,546.23 Lakhs. Company has an average EPS of Rs 3.91 and average RoNW of 24.49% for last three fiscals. Issue is priced at a P/BV of 3.77 as per NAV of Rs 24.64/- as on (30.09.25 ). If we attribute latest earnings of FY24, FY25 and annualised FY26 on equity post issue, then asking price is at a P/E of around 46.64, 21.54 and 13.98 respectively.
